You're gonna go and buy a $275 race day shoe and then wear cotton socks? Insanity. Find out why running socks matter, what kind you should look for, and which ones we prefer. It can be a little overwhelming at first, but we break it down for you, from synthetic to merino, crew to no-show, max cushion to lite cushion. What's your favorite running sock?
